Welcome to Earthbound Gardeners! My intent for my new blog is to provide basic, hands-on, easy-to understand gardening tips and advice for everyday people. (Like me!) Meet the Earthbound Gardener!I grew up in world that revolved around agriculture and gardening, and I’ve had my hands in the dirt for a lot of years. These days, more people are discovering the joy and tremendous satisfaction that goes along with growing things with their own two hands.

If this is you, yay! Don’t be overwhelmed and don’t be intimidated. Gardening can be as difficult or as involved as you want it to be, but it can also be as easy as (mud) pie.

Either way, first things first. Get yourself a basic understanding of plants and gardening terminology, and you’re on your way. If you’re an old hand at gardening, I hope my blog is helpful and interesting to you as well.

While this blog is definitely not intended to be a daily diary of my life, the weather, my personal observations or my political viewpoint, I’ll tuck observations and thoughts here and there when I think it’s appropriate and not too boring. For example, I’m very concerned about invasive and non-native plants, and I’m sure I’ll be preaching about that subject here and there. Similarly, I’m worried about the loss of bees, as we should all be.

Some other things I’m passionate about are wildflowers and native plants. I’ll get into that more as we go along. I may even spend some time writing about Eastern Oregon – the beautiful, isolated, dry two-thirds of the state that nobody knows about.
